Detailed Engineering Specifications

A proven choice for industrial professionals, this Titanium Grade 5 stock sheet exhibits a nominal thickness of 0.150 inches, with precise dimensions of 18 inches in length and 22 inches in width. Composed of Titanium alloy Grade 5 (Ti-6Al-4V), it boasts a tensile strength typically exceeding 130 ksi and a yield strength of over 120 ksi, coupled with excellent fracture toughness and fatigue resistance. Common Mistakes & How to Avoid Them

❌ Mistake✅ Correct Approach
Using standard steel cutting tools without proper lubrication or cooling.Employ specialized carbide or high-speed steel tooling with generous coolant flow and reduced cutting speeds to prevent excessive heat buildup and tool wear.
Attempting to weld Titanium Grade 5 without inert gas shielding.Always use a TIG welding process with Argon shielding gas to prevent oxidation and embrittlement of the weld zone.

⚠️ Engineering Warnings

  • Titanium dust generated during machining can be pyrophoric and requires proper handling and disposal procedures.
  • Avoid prolonged exposure to elevated temperatures in oxidizing atmospheres, which can lead to surface degradation.
